01202159712 Summary (Read all comments)
Phone number ☎️ 01202159712 👆 is reported as a persistent nuisance scam linked to loft insulation offers, typically involving automated or pre-recorded calls from afar, falsely claiming to be local energy advisors or government representatives. Callers often pressure recipients to book free surveys or warn about alleged insulation issues causing damp, despite lacking property details or evidence. Many note the use of varying numbers to bypass blocking, with calls frequently ending abruptly when interest is declined. These calls have caused frustration due to their repetitive, misleading nature, and attempts to extract personal information. Recipients are advised to remain cautious, avoid engagement, block the numbers, and rely on official channels for home energy consultations.

About 01 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by residential and commercial properties.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that allow free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with many pl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
